Basque vs Immigrants from South Central Asia Wage/Income Gap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 165,712,843 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Basques and wage/income gap percentage in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.346 and weighted average of 28.8%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 472,660,484 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from South Central Asia and wage/income gap percentage in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.385 and weighted average of 29.3%, a difference of 1.9%.
